The Push to Suspend Habeas Corpus

  • 💡 The discussion centers on a segment where Steve Bannon and MAGA influencer DC Draino (Rogan O'Handley) argued that Donald Trump should suspend habeas corpus.
  • 🎯 This is framed as a necessary step for mass deportations, with the argument that "illegal aliens" do not have rights in the U.S.
  • 🏛️ The transcript highlights the constitutional clause (Article 1, Section 9, Clause 2) that allows suspension only in cases of rebellion or invasion.

Historical Precedents and Modern Claims

  • 📜 DC Draino cited historical figures like FDR, Abraham Lincoln, and Ulysses S. Grant as presidents who have used or suspended habeas corpus.
  • ⚠️ The transcript counters that these historical uses were in specific contexts of rebellion or invasion, and that current arguments twist these precedents.
